CPU的主频与指令执行速度是什么关系?

[复制链接]
查看11 | 回复5 | 2019-12-26 16:25:46 | 显示全部楼层 |阅读模式
主频越高,指令执行速度越快。CPU的主频不代表CPU的速度,但提高主频对于提高CPU运算速度却是至关重要的。主频和实际的运算速度存在一定的关系,但并不是一个简单的线性关系。主频表示在CPU内数字脉冲信号震荡的速度,CPU的运算速度还要看CPU的流水线、总线等各方面的性能指标。也就是说,主频仅仅是CPU性能表现的一个方面,而不代表CPU的整体性能。扩展资料:主频和实际的运算速度存在一定的关系,但还没有一个确定的公式能够定量两者的数值关系,因为CPU的运算速度还要看CPU的流水线的各方面的性能指标(缓存、指...
回复

使用道具 举报

千问 | 2019-12-26 16:25:46 | 显示全部楼层
主频越高,指令执行速度越快。CPU的主频,即CPU内核工作的时钟频率(CPU Clock Speed)。通常所说的某某CPU是多少兆赫的,而这个多少兆赫就是"CPU的主频"。很多人认为CPU的主频就是其运行速度,其实不然。CPU的主频表示在CPU内数字脉冲信号震荡的速度,与CPU实际的运算能力并没有直接关系。由于主频并不直接代表运算速度,所以在一定情...
回复

使用道具 举报

千问 | 2019-12-26 16:25:46 | 显示全部楼层
也就是单位时间内处理器能够产生多少个时钟信号理论上频率越高速度越快,但到频率上G的时代后,出现了一个新概念:执行效率INTEL追求高频率,但由于产品设计的流水线长度太长,导致执行效率低下(当一个线程执行到后期发现处理错误要重头执行,这就知道流水线长度和执行效率的关系了),而且主频太高所造成的发热量和功耗也是一大无法改进的缺点,这是一把双刃剑而AM...
回复

使用道具 举报

千问 | 2019-12-26 16:25:46 | 显示全部楼层
在电脑数据通信中计算数据传输速率常使用公式:时钟频率×数据总线宽度÷8=Betys/s。在电脑系统中,CPU与系统内存、显示接口(如AGP“总线”)以及通过主板芯片组与扩展总线(ISA、PCI)之间进行数据交换时,是按相应的时钟频率进行的。例如当系统时钟为66MHz时,系统内存与CPU之间的数据传输率是528MB/s,AGP高速显示接口工作在X1方式的时钟频...
回复

使用道具 举报

千问 | 2019-12-26 16:25:46 | 显示全部楼层
也就是单位时间内处理器能够产生多少个时钟信号理论上频率越高速度越快,但到频率上G的时代后,出现了一个新概念:执行效率INTEL追求高频率,但由于产品设计的流水线长度太长,导致执行效率低下(当一个线程执行到后期发现处理错误要重头执行,这就知道流水线长度和执行效率的关系了),而且主频太高所造成的发热量和功耗也是一大无法改进的缺点,这是一把双刃剑...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行